Prices & Trends

Avalon is weird in the best way. You're on Catalina Island with a median price of $650,000, but only 32.6% of people own here. Most residents rent, and that creates opportunity if you know how to finance it right. Prices held flat this year, no dramatic swings. The conforming loan limit is $1.25M, so you've got full access to conventional, FHA, and VA without hitting jumbo territory. Honestly, the financing part is easier than people expect. The challenge is finding what's for sale in a town of 3,000 people.

Who's Buying in Avalon

Two types of buyers dominate here. First-time buyers who want the island lifestyle and can swing the $89K median household income reality. And investors who see that 32.6% homeownership rate and smell rental opportunity. Young families relocating from LA or Orange County find this affordable compared to mainland coastal towns. You're not competing with tech money like you would in Santa Monica. The small inventory means you need to move fast when something hits the market, but the financing side is straightforward at this price point.

Your Loan Fit

Conventional and FHA both work well at $650K. Your choice depends on what you're bringing to the table.
  • FHA at 3.5% down gets you in for around $23K, solid option if you're tight on cash but have decent credit
  • Conventional at 5% down (about $33K) usually gets better rates and lower monthly payments long-term
  • VA loans are unbeatable if you're a veteran, zero down and no PMI
  • USDA might apply since Avalon qualifies as rural, but income limits can disqualify you at $89K household
Real talk: most people go conventional or FHA. The math shifts based on your credit score and how long you're staying.

Down Payment & Refinance in Avalon

Already own here? Refinancing makes sense in a few scenarios. Cash-out refi is huge for island properties where renovation costs run high and contractors are limited. If you bought with FHA and have 20% equity now, ditch that PMI and save $200+ monthly. Rate-term refi works if rates drop or your credit improved since you bought. Investors with rentals should look at DSCR loans, they qualify based on rental income not your W2. The stable pricing means your equity isn't growing fast, but you can still leverage what you've built.

Why Avalon is a Great Place to Buy a Home

Avalon is the only incorporated city on Catalina Island, 22 miles off the coast of LA County. Population is 3,441, median household income $89,131. The homeownership rate sits at just 32.6%, and here's why that matters: this is a vacation home and investment property market more than a traditional buy-and-settle town. At $650K median home price, you're paying a premium for island living, and most buyers here are either looking at second homes, short-term rental income properties, or they've got jobs tied to the island's tourism economy and can handle the unique financing challenges that come with limited inventory and seasonal cash flow.

Schools & Family Appeal

The school situation on Catalina is pretty straightforward because there's literally one of each. Avalon Elementary scores a 7, Avalon Middle a 6, Avalon High a 7. Small class sizes are the norm when your entire K-12 system serves maybe 200 kids total. If you're buying here with school-age children, you're committing to a very different lifestyle than mainland California. Most families who make this work are either deeply tied to the island economy or they've structured remote income that lets them prioritize the tight-knit community over access to diverse programs. Resale to other families is possible but your buyer pool is narrow, which affects how lenders look at the property.

The Neighborhood Feel

Where you buy on Catalina directly impacts your financing options and rental income potential. Avalon Bay runs $500K-$800K, mostly charming cottages and condos right near the harbor and ferry terminal. These properties work well with conventional loans if you can document short-term rental income for qualification. Hamilton Cove is the luxury play at $700K-$1.2M, upscale condos and townhomes with resort amenities that attract vacation home buyers using jumbo loans or cash. Middle Ranch offers $450K-$750K single-family homes set back from the waterfront, better for year-round residents who want space and can qualify based on stable island employment. Pebbly Beach runs $600K-$900K with beachfront access and limited inventory, which means you'll face competition and need pre-approval ready before anything decent hits the market. The truth is, most lenders treat Catalina properties as second homes or investment properties by default, so your down payment requirements start at 10-20% minimum, not the 3-5% you'd see for primary residence loans on the mainland.

Getting Around

There's no commute here in the traditional sense because you can't drive to the mainland. You're taking the Catalina Express ferry, which runs about an hour to Long Beach or San Pedro, and costs $75-$80 round trip per person. That's your connection to the outside world for groceries you can't get on island, medical specialists, or mainland business. Most residents use golf carts or walk because Avalon is tiny and parking is limited. If you're financing a property here, lenders want to see you understand the cost structure of island living, because your monthly expenses include ferry trips, higher utility costs, and limited shopping options that add up fast.

Jobs & Economy

The Santa Catalina Island Company is the big employer here, running hotels, restaurants, and tours that drive the tourism economy. Catalina Island Conservancy manages most of the island's interior and employs conservation staff. City of Avalon provides municipal jobs, Avalon Unified School District covers education, and Catalina Express operates the ferry service. USC Wrigley Marine Science Center brings research jobs and seasonal student housing demand. Real talk, if you're buying here and need a mortgage based on W-2 income, you're probably working for one of these employers or you're in hospitality. Most buyers either have remote income, retirement funds, or they're purchasing investment properties and using projected rental income to qualify. The seasonal nature of the economy means lenders scrutinize your income stability more carefully than they would for a comparable property in Long Beach.
